St. Petersburg, April 8 – RIA Novosti. The first baby seal this year was rescued from the territory of a dam in St. Petersburg, Vodokanal of St. Petersburg reported. “The first pet, a very emaciated gray seal, was taken to the rescue center on the territory of the Vodokanal of St. Petersburg in the village of Repino. The weight of the cub is only 15 kilograms, and at the beginning of ‘an independent life’, the baby should weigh more than 40 kilograms. Only with such a mass does it not freeze in cold water and can learn to hunt fish, ”says the publication. Specialists from the Baltic Seal Friends Foundation will provide qualified assistance to the seal. Since 2013, the State Unitary Enterprise “Vodokanal of St. Petersburg” has been involved in the work to save marine mammals in the Baltic region. The opening of the first modern specialized center for the rehabilitation of marine mammals in Russia, including quarantine and adaptation blocks and outdoor swimming pools, took place in 2014. Employees of the facility were able to rescue and restore nature more than 130 seals and seals. The most famous area in the center is the male Ladoga ringed seal Kroshik. After his rehabilitation, they tried to release him back into the wild twice, but each time he came back. A few years later, Kroshik had a permanent neighbor – a male seal Ladoga Shlissik. He also “preferred” life on the territory of the center of Repino to the natural habitat.
